Job Description

Mercy Neurology is seeking board certified or board eligible Neurologist to join an established Neurohospitalist program on the campus of Mercy Hospital St. Louis. Our Mercy Neurohospitalist team consists of six Neurohospitalist, six Advanced Practitioners, stroke coordinators/navigators and an engaged support staff focused on quality patient care.

Mercy Neurology Offers:

Attractive block schedule of 7 on 7 off
No nighttime call duties
Providing clinical services at one hospital location
Consult – only service, and will not be required to be the attending of record
APP on every shift to help staff and round on patients.
Providing tele neurology across four states to our smaller outlying hospitals
Outpatient support from our large General Neurology group
Teaching opportunities
Additional Telestroke shifts available, if desired!
